Abstract

The utility model discloses a kind of mineral hot furnace furnace shells, including furnace wall and expansion plate made of being enclosed as the welding of several coverboards, expansion plate includes both ends and the arch pars contractilis being connected between both ends, the coverboard welding adjacent with the two of furnace wall respectively of the both ends of expansion plate, arch pars contractilis radially outward the arching upward along furnace wall of expansion plate.The mineral hot furnace furnace shell, the expansion plate being connected between the adjacent coverboard in furnace wall two includes arch pars contractilis, and the flexible space of arch pars contractilis of expansion plate is big, furnace wall expansion, when expansion plate is by the larger power of pullling, the arch pars contractilis of expansion plate can pull power by straightening the deformation of trend to eliminate this, compared to the connecting plate that tradition is straight panel, its tensile property is more preferable, itself is not easy to crack, so that the connection between two coverboards of furnace wall is more reliable, service life is greatly prolonged.

A kind of mineral hot furnace furnace shell
Technical field
The utility model relates to mineral hot furnace technical field, especially a kind of mineral hot furnace furnace shell.
Background technique
The main function of mineral hot furnace furnace shell is the refractory material for waling its liner, and in this, as molten bath, accommodates and constantly add The furnace charge and molten metal solution entered, periodically releases metallic solution by converter nose.Mineral hot furnace furnace shell, including by several coverboard rivetings Cylindric furnace wall made of weldering encloses.Mineral hot furnace in use, with in-furnace temperature raising, the refractory material of wall lining and Furnace wall expansion, easily cracks the furnace wall of furnace shell.To solve the above problems, existing mineral hot furnace furnace shell, the usually two adjacent shells in furnace wall Solid welding connecting plate between plate, connecting plate are the straight panel for being tightly attached to furnace wall coverboard, and the space of dilatation is small, though it can be risen in the short time Connection reinforcement effect between two plate shells of furnace wall, but in the expansion of furnace wall long term high temperature or as degrees of expansion increases, connecting plate institute It is pullled and is insisted in long and biggish situation, connecting plate itself is easily opened because that can not eliminate the biggish power of pullling by deformation It splits, loses booster action, the reinforcing effect that can be played is limited.
Summary of the invention
The purpose of this utility model is to provide a kind of mineral hot furnace furnace shells.
For realization the purpose of this utility model, its technical solution is now described in detail: a kind of mineral hot furnace furnace shell, including by several Furnace wall and expansion plate made of coverboard welding encloses, expansion plate includes that both ends and the arch being connected between both ends are stretched Contracting portion, adjacent with the two of the furnace wall coverboard welding respectively of the both ends of expansion plate, the radial direction of the arch pars contractilis of expansion plate along furnace wall It arches upward outward.
Further, the staggered reinforcing rib of several transverse and longitudinals is distributed in the coverboard outer surface of furnace wall.Add by the way that transverse and longitudinal is staggered The setting of strengthening tendons keeps the structure of coverboard stronger, bigger because expanding the power that can be born.
Further, expansion plate is symmetrical arranged along two adjacent coverboard intersecting lenses.By the way that expansion plate to be symmetrical arranged, make its work For two adjacent coverboard active force it is more balanced, will not crack because one end stress is excessive.
The utility model mineral hot furnace furnace shell, the expansion plate being connected between the adjacent coverboard in furnace wall two includes arch pars contractilis, is stretched The flexible space of arch pars contractilis of contracting plate is big, furnace wall expansion, when expansion plate is by the larger power of pullling, the arch of expansion plate Pars contractilis can pull power by straightening the deformation of trend to eliminate this, compared to the connecting plate that tradition is straight panel, tensile property is more Good, itself is not easy to crack, so that the connection between two coverboards of furnace wall is more reliable, service life is greatly prolonged.
